Praz and Simon have been discussing a deal for the last several minutes. Praz has the chip lead, approximately 800k to Simon's 600k and wants more money than what was initially offered. Funnily enough though, neither are too keen to gamble for that 20k difference.

Still level pegging. Blinds now 10/20k (and capped).
Lots of action, but very back and forth, not too many hands reaching the river.
Last 3 hands:
(1) Praz raises 60k, Simon calls. 8h-7d-6d Flop. Check, check. 9s Turn. Simon bets 90k and Praz folds. Simon shows T-9.
(2) 4-8-5 rainbow Flop. Praz checks, Simons bets 30k, Praz calls. 4d Turn. Simon bets 80k, Praz folds.
(3) Jc 9c 5d Flop. Praz bets 30k, called. 4h Turn. Praz bets 70k. Folds.
